Brandon Aiyuk: Draft Analysis, News, and More

Early Life and College Career

Brandon Aiyuk was born in Rocklin, California, and played college football at Arizona State University. As a sophomore in 2019, he emerged as a star wide receiver, recording 1,192 receiving yards and eight touchdowns. His impressive performance earned him All-American honors.

NFL Draft and San Francisco 49ers

In the 2020 NFL Draft, Aiyuk was selected by the San Francisco 49ers in the first round with the 25th overall pick. The 49ers acquired the pick from the Minnesota Vikings in a trade.

Versatile Wideout

Aiyuk possesses a versatile skill set that makes him a valuable asset to the 49ers offense. He is a skilled route runner with good hands and the ability to make plays in both the slot and on the outside. He is also an adept blocker, which makes him a key contributor to the team's running game.
